Going to Cairns (yorkys) to kite, is there any "clear water" off the beach, or is it always murky, right now i kite on the Sunny coast.

Alas, the water is generally always murky, especially at this time of year as all the wet season rain has flushed out the rivers.
By the time you ride out to the clear water its time to head back to shore.
